From: The ROCK-ezrin signaling pathway mediates LPS-induced cytokine production in pulmonary alveolar epithelial cells

Fig. 1

LPS induced ezrin phosphorylation in a concentration- and time-dependent manner. A549 and HPAEpiC cells were treated with LPS for 3 h at concentrations of 0 µg/mL, 0.1 µg/mL, 1 µg/mL, and 10 µg/mL, respectively. Phosphorylated ezrin protein level was evaluated by western blotting (a, b) and flow cytometry (c, d). A549 and HPAEpiC cells were treated with LPS (1 µg/mL) for 0 h, 0.5 h, 1 h, 3 h, 6 h and 12 h, respectively. Phosphorylated ezrin protein level was evaluated by western blotting (e, f) and flow cytometry (g, h). Data are expressed as means ± SD of triplicate samples. *p < 0.05 versus 0 µg/mL group
